What size tires and do you have a lift? Love how those shoes look!
Thanks! Both pics are on 37x12.5x17's. The Mickey Thompson Baja Boss (first photo) are just a little wider, a little taller, and the sidewalls are much more aggressive.

I'm running the @Clayton Off Road Overland 2.5" Lift. It's actually closer to a 3.5" lift (It's like Max Tow, you always have to say it.). Seriously, I only say it here because you're not going to the the same stance with a Mopar 2" lift.

I love these tires so far.
